Wiring terminal strips

Solid or flexible cables are permitted as signal lines. Wire end ferrules must not be used for
the spring-loaded terminals.
The permissible cable cross-section ranges between 0.5 mm² (21 AWG) and 1.5 mm² (16
AWG). When completely connecting-up the unit, we recommend cables with a cross-section
of 1mm² (18 AWG).
Route the signal lines so that you can again completely close the front doors after
connecting-up the terminal strip. If you use shielded cables, then you must connect the
shield to the mounting plate of the control cabinet or with the shield support of the inverter
through a good electrical connection and a large surface area.
NOTICE
To ensure operating safety even when connecting 230 V to the Control Unit relay outputs
DO 0 and DO 2, for these connections cables with double insulation must be used.
